# TilePull Artifact Signing

TilePull is Norvane's map-tile prefetcher. All release artifacts must be signed before the deploy pipeline accepts them. Build the tarball with `make dist`, then sign with the release key held by the Platform group. Unsigned builds are rejected at the gate — no exceptions, even for hotfixes. Verify signatures locally before pushing. Contractors get read access to the key registry only. The current public signing key is shown below.

deploy key for kajof-fajop: bky6_gDHw9Q

Alert: tailgrove-cli session limit exceeded. This fires when the Tailgrove log-tailing CLI opens more than fifty concurrent streaming sessions against the Orrin log cluster, which usually indicates a stuck script rather than genuine demand. Please identify the offending host, terminate stale sessions, and confirm the count drops below threshold. Detailed remediation steps and safe-kill commands are documented on our internal runbook page.

wiki page, yagef-fahaf: https://grafana.ferracorp.corp/spaces/view/projects/board/job/board/issue/dddcb27874b55298d2204852

## Runbook: Payment Retry Idempotency

Fernpay retries failed charges up to three times. Each attempt carries an idempotency key derived from the order hash; duplicate keys are rejected upstream by the Coinloft gateway. If retries start double-charging, the key-signing secret is missing or stale. Check the worker env first. Regenerate via the vault tooling, then ensure the env file contains the following line.

vault entry, kafog-yahop: COURIER_KEY8=0faa53ae

Handover Note — Front Desk, Pellgrove Tower

Hi Maret,

A few things before my leave: visitor sign-in now uses the Greetly tablet, not the paper log, and badges must be collected back before 6 p.m. Always phone the host before sending anyone up — even regulars like the Ostenfeld couriers. The badge printer jams if you rush it; pause between prints. If the lobby turnstile freezes, which happens most Mondays, unlock it with the code below.

badge for kahog-tagef: bdg-B-37

// Tide-table widget for the Saltmere embed framework.
// Plugin authors: the widget interpolates between harmonic samples
// and caches predictions per station. Overriding these constants is
// supported, but keep the cache window larger than the refresh
// interval or you will see flicker. The defaults are:

tuning constants:
BUDGETS = {
    "druath": 240,
    "lamwyn": 180,
    "silael": 275,
}